Jeanetta Burnham
During the time I spent working with Amy at the Richland College Library, she was a leader in implementing a number of e-learning strategies. One of her projects was creating an electronic badge program for our series of three information literacy classes. As an early adopter of the electronic badge technology, she was able to encourage a number of instructors to utilize the badge system she created in their own classes. Amy also created an MLA format tutorial that was widely used on campus and created various other online tutorials to teach information literacy skills.
